Welcome aboard. We're seeing sporadic "pool exhausted" errors on the Lanternfall checkout service during peak traffic. Current theory: the pooler is configured with a max of 20 connections, but recent autoscaling means we sometimes run 40 workers against the same pool. Please reproduce locally first — start the service with the staging profile, trigger the load script, and watch the pool metrics. For reproduction, point your local instance at the staging database using the connection string that follows.

primary connection of yagep-kahip = redis://giliel_svc:zYiKsLL2PLpfPL@db-348f.xolmarsys.corp:5432/fenwyn

Management Meeting Minutes — Tallowmere Expansion

Attendees agreed the Tallowmere region is ready: distributor terms with Bryncroft Trading are nearly final, and local hiring starts next month. Marta Quill will lead the launch team. Budget stays within the envelope approved in spring. One open item: warehouse lease timing. Full expansion details follow in the confidential note below.

internal memo for hahif-hahaf: Headcount on the Zorwyn team goes from 9 to 100 by the end of October. Gross margin on Zorwyn came in at 5 percent against a plan of 10 percent.

During the outage, missed watering jobs were silently dropped instead of queued, so several greenhouse zones went two cycles without water. The fix adds a catch-up pass on scheduler restart, capped at one backfilled run per zone. Support should expect tickets about "double watering" during the first week after rollout — this is the catch-up pass working as intended. Customer-facing talking points and the rollout timeline are posted here.

wiki page, bawef-hafop: https://jira.nelvroworks.corp/job/pages/projects/7c5c0f440dbd

Handover: nightly backfill scheduler (Dunlin)

Status: stable after last week's retry fix. Queue drains by 04:30 on normal nights. Known issue: overlapping windows when a backfill exceeds six hours — scheduler skips, doesn't stack. Monitor the skip counter. No open incidents. Current scheduler configuration for reference at the sync is as follows.

settings of fajog-kajof:
julwyn:
  pin: 0480
  tenant: rusok
  seal: seal_456f5567
  metrics_host: metrics.julwyn.qirvangrid.local
  standby_team: rusath
  escalation: eliael-jorax
  nonce: ca9746